What Is Cerium Oxide?
Cerium oxide is a fine, white powder derived from cerium, a rare earth element. It is highly effective for polishing glass because it reacts with the silica in the glass surface, gently removing scratches, oxidation, and imperfections. Cerium oxide is favored over other abrasives because it provides a smooth, glossy finish without causing deep scratches or further damage. It is commonly used in glass repair, lens polishing, and even in automotive glass restoration.
Forms and Preparation
Cerium oxide is available in both powder and pre-mixed slurry forms. For polishing, the powder is usually mixed with water to create a paste or slurry, which is then applied to the glass surface. The consistency of the slurry can affect the polishing process, so it’s important to follow recommended proportions, typically a ratio of one part water to two parts cerium oxide powder. The slurry should be smooth and free of lumps to ensure even polishing.
Tools Needed for Polishing Glass
Polishing glass with cerium oxide requires specific tools to achieve optimal results. These include
- Polishing Pad or Felt WheelAttached to a rotary tool or drill, it evenly applies the cerium oxide slurry to the glass surface.
- Spray Bottle or Water SourceKeeps the surface wet during polishing to prevent overheating and ensure smooth movement of the abrasive.
- Microfiber ClothsUsed for cleaning and inspecting the glass during and after polishing.
- Safety GearProtective gloves, goggles, and a mask to prevent irritation from the powder.
Step-by-Step Process for Polishing Glass
Polishing glass with cerium oxide requires patience and attention to detail. The following steps outline a general procedure for achieving a clear, smooth finish
1. Clean the Glass Surface
Before polishing, thoroughly clean the glass to remove dust, dirt, and grease. Any debris left on the surface can cause additional scratches during polishing. Use a gentle glass cleaner and a microfiber cloth, ensuring the surface is completely dry before proceeding.
2. Prepare the Cerium Oxide Slurry
Mix cerium oxide powder with water to create a smooth slurry. The consistency should be slightly thick but spreadable. Some professionals add a few drops of dish soap to help the slurry adhere to the glass surface during polishing.
3. Apply the Slurry
Place a small amount of the slurry on the polishing pad or directly on the scratched area. Ensure that the pad or wheel is fully covered but not overloaded, as excessive slurry can reduce the effectiveness of the polish.
4. Start Polishing
Use a rotary tool, drill, or hand applicator to polish the glass. Move the pad in circular motions, applying gentle pressure. Keep the area wet with water to prevent heat buildup, which can damage the glass. Continue polishing for several minutes, periodically checking the progress.
5. Inspect and Repeat
After initial polishing, wipe away the slurry and inspect the glass. Minor scratches may require additional polishing cycles. Repeat the process as necessary until the surface is smooth and clear.
6. Final Cleaning
Once the desired result is achieved, clean the glass thoroughly to remove any residual cerium oxide. Use a soft microfiber cloth and a gentle glass cleaner to ensure a streak-free, polished finish.
Tips for Effective Polishing
To maximize results when using cerium oxide, consider the following tips
- Maintain a wet surface at all times to prevent the glass from overheating.
- Use consistent, even pressure to avoid creating uneven spots.
- Start with smaller, less noticeable areas to practice and refine technique.
- Replace the polishing pad if it becomes worn or clogged with powder.
- Be patient; achieving a professional finish may take multiple polishing sessions.
Applications of Cerium Oxide Polishing
Cerium oxide polishing is used in various contexts due to its effectiveness and safety for glass surfaces
Automotive Glass Restoration
Minor scratches, water spots, and oxidation on car windshields and windows can be polished away with cerium oxide, improving visibility and overall appearance.
Home and Decorative Glass
Windows, glass tabletops, mirrors, and decorative pieces can regain their original clarity and shine through careful polishing with cerium oxide.
Optical Lenses and Instruments
Precision polishing of eyeglasses, camera lenses, and other optical instruments often uses cerium oxide due to its ability to smooth surfaces without compromising clarity.
Art and Craft Projects
Glass artists and hobbyists use cerium oxide to finish blown glass, stained glass, and other handmade items, ensuring a professional-looking final product.
Safety Considerations
While cerium oxide is generally safe to use, certain precautions should be taken
- Wear protective gloves and goggles to prevent irritation.
- Use a dust mask if working with dry powder to avoid inhalation.
- Ensure proper ventilation when working indoors.
- Avoid contact with sensitive skin and clean any spills promptly.
